Output 8f3f32d2a1ef83ee7f851d91842abfa35f66c0d02e40107c69b91c12cbb3bc92:3

value
10887912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 088d516af46c71b9313a71e87546ad18dceee28e OP_EQUAL
address
32UEd2Zt84gpujZEDPBo3jy2xkxXWebVDF
transaction
8f3f32d2a1ef83ee7f851d91842abfa35f66c0d02e40107c69b91c12cbb3bc92
spent
true